{"id":11868,"date":"2026-03-19T23:24:31","date_gmt":"2026-03-19T23:24:31","guid":{"rendered":"https:\/\/www.housetoastonish.com\/?p=11868"},"modified":"2026-03-19T23:24:31","modified_gmt":"2026-03-19T23:24:31","slug":"the-x-axis-18-march-2026","status":"publish","type":"post","link":"https:\/\/www.housetoastonish.com\/?p=11868","title":{"rendered":"The X-Axis &#8211; 18 March 2026"},"content":{"rendered":"<p><strong>X-MEN #27.\u00a0<\/strong><a href=\"https:\/\/www.housetoastonish.com\/?p=11865\">(Annotations here.)<\/a> Part 2 of &#8220;Danger Room&#8221; is an issue devoted to introducing the members of Maxine Danger&#8217;s think tank &#8211; the X-Men themselves don&#8217;t get that much to do, since a lot of the issue is flashbacks setting up their back story and recruitment. They&#8217;re unusual villains to get so much time, since none of them actually has any particular interest in the X-Men or even in mutants in general &#8211; they&#8217;re just psychos who have been enlisted by Maxine Danger, who herself doesn&#8217;t actually have an obvious interest in the X-Men beyond charging for her services. I&#8217;m in two minds about this arc, right now &#8211; they all get a nice enough introduction, and Diaz&#8217;s art gives them a neat contrast with Maxine&#8217;s lunatic office manager. Colton and Jackson are rather similar characters, too, though I do like the other two being (likely) delusional killers who are convinced that they&#8217;re Skrulls trapped in human form. But as an X-Men story it does feel at the moment like we&#8217;re just chucking random stuff at the team for them to fight. Still, Jed MacKay gets the benefit of doubt that this is heading somewhere more than that, since it wouldn&#8217;t be his style.<\/p>\n<p><strong>CYCLOPS #2.<\/strong> By Alex Paknadel, Rog\u00ea Ant\u00f4nio, Fer Sifuentes-Sujo &amp; Joe Caramagna. Well, this is fun. Sure, having Cyclops lose his visor and have to work around his uncontrollable powers is a well established routine, but it&#8217;s one we haven&#8217;t done in a good long while, and Paknadel and Ant\u00f4nio do it rather well. The plot may hinge on a massive coincidence of Cyclops stumbling upon the new Reavers&#8217; scheme, but now that we&#8217;re here, we&#8217;ve got an escaped mutant who was never that keen on Krakoa and isn&#8217;t immediately in awe of Scott, which gives him someone to win over. Mostly, though, we&#8217;ve got the new Reavers squabbling among themselves as Donald Pierce tries to keep them all in line, and they&#8217;re turning out to be quite entertaining. We&#8217;re not dealing with professional soldiers any more, just wide-eyed cultists who&#8217;ve signed up for dubious cyborg conversion. They&#8217;ve got the equipment but they have no real idea what they&#8217;re doing, and Pierce seems to be making do with a bunch of underlings who have been powered up to the point where they can at least shove some non-combatants about. Paknadel gives him a sort of weary disdain that somehow feels a bit more developed to me than he has in a while. It&#8217;s a good take on the character.<\/p>\n<p><!--more--><\/p>\n<p><strong>X-MEN OF APOCALYPSE #3.\u00a0<\/strong>By Jeph Loeb, Simone Di Meo, Richard Starkings &amp; Comicraft. I really cannot rouse myself to care about this. There&#8217;s nothing to the story beyond an excuse to lurch from fight scene to fight scene, unless you count AoA Gambit getting excited to meet a past version of mainstream Rogue. Except&#8230; that depends on Gambit still being in love with Rogue. And while he\u00a0<em>did<\/em> have a back story that involved her choosing Magneto over him, and a storyline about him still being in love her, didn&#8217;t that get resolved in\u00a0<em>Gambit &amp; The X-Ternals<\/em>? Doesn&#8217;t he surrender his love for Rogue in exchange for a shard of the M&#8217;Kraan Crystal, or something like that? Oh well. As with previous issues, it&#8217;s pretty on an individual panel level, though it struggles with flow and doesn&#8217;t do a great job with atmosphere &#8211; Di Meo is awfully keen on motion-blurring his backgrounds, which doesn&#8217;t help. But mostly, it&#8217;s Just Stuff Happening.<\/p>\n","protected":false},"excerpt":{"rendered":"<p>X-MEN #27.\u00a0(Annotations here.)
